Title :
Hierarchical Internal Migration Regions of France

Abstract :
Internal migration tables can be employed to ascertain functional migration regions¿collections of geographic units with relatively large intraregional flows and relatively small interregional movements. A two-stage algorithm that has been utilized to study tables for various nations is applied here to a 21 à 21 French matrix. In the first step, the square table is adjusted to possess uniform marginal (row and column) sums. The doubly standardized table obtained can be regarded as an asymmetric similarity matrix. It serves, in the second stage, as input to a hierarchical clustering procedure, based on the concep of the strong components of a directed graph. Région Parisienne and Centre are shown to have the broadest migration bases. Well-defined southern and northwestern regions are found.
